Slovene Ski Jumpers Beat Soininen, Parma and Others
Velenje, 2 July - SPORTS/SKI/JUMPING
Primož Kopač, Slovene ski-jumper, won the 9th international ski-jumping night competition on the plastic ski jump in Velenje (north-eastern Slovenia). Slovene ski jumpers occupied the first five places and beat famous ski jumpers such as Jani Soininen of Finland and Jiri Parma of the Czech Republic, who were the sixth and the seventh. Another international event, the 5th Ford Ski Jumping Challenger, is scheduled for Sunday evening. Slovene ski jumper Franci Petek, World Champion in Predazzo 1991, is to end his career at this competition.
